Considerations
Position Busy allows one of two attendant positions to be made inactive when not required. This is
useful in situations where calling traffic requires only one console operator.
Interactions
The following features interact with Attendant Position Busy.
Attendant Call Extending: Unanswered calls extended by an inactive console will return to the
active console on the Return-On-Don't-Answer (RTN-DA) button (DTAC only) or on a Loop button
(SLAC only).
Attendant Camp-On: Calls Camped-On by an inactive console will return to the active console
when Camp-On timeout occurs.
Attendant Message Waiting: An inactive attendant is permitted to control voice terminal Message
LEDs.
Automatic Intercom: The inactive attendant is permitted to place Automatic Intercom calls. DTAC
only: Automatic Intercom calls to the inactive attendant will not ring at the console or be transferred
to the active attendant when the AUTO ICOM button is located in one of the two rightmost button
columns.
Backup Station (Single SLAC): If the Backup station is a member of a DGC group, it must be
logged into the group to receive attendant calls.
Coverage:
● DTAC only—If the active attendant is a coverage receiver for the inactive attendant,
coverage is invoked and calls will appear at the active attendant’s Cover button. If the
inactive attendant is a coverage receiver for the active attendant, coverage, when
activated, is invoked at all coverage stations, including the inactive attendant. However, if
the Cover button is located in one of the two rightmost button columns, coverage calls will
not ring at these buttons.
● SLAC only—All calls covered by the common queue will be directed to the active console.
Direct Group Calling: If the attendant is a member of a DGC Group, calls directed to the group
will be routed to the attendant. The attendant must dial ✶ 4 to log out of the group. Dialing ✶ 6 re-
enters (logs into) the group.
Direct Inward Dialing: All DID calls to unassigned DID numbers will be transferred to the active
attendant.
